Thigh Lift Recovery Timeline
First Week Post-Surgery: During the first few days, you’ll experience swelling, bruising, and mild discomfort, which are normal while healing. Your surgeon will provide compression garments to minimize swelling and support your thighs as they heal. Rest during this time, avoid strenuous activities, and take short, light walks to improve circulation.
Weeks 2-4: Swelling and bruising will subside, making you feel more comfortable moving around. Many patients return to work during this period, provided their job doesn’t involve heavy lifting or extensive physical activity. However, avoiding intense exercise is crucial to allow proper healing.
Week 6 and Beyond: By six weeks, most swelling should have diminished, and you’ll notice the contour of your thighs improving. You can resume your regular exercise routine, but always follow your surgeon’s guidance to avoid complications.
Full results typically become visible after three months, once all swelling has resolved and scars fade.
Recovery Tips for a Smooth Healing Process
- Follow Your Surgeon’s Instructions: Adhere to post-operative care guidelines, including wound care, medications, and activity restrictions.
- Wear Compression Garments: These garments are effective for minimizing swelling and supporting your thighs during recovery.
- Stay Hydrated and Maintain a Balanced Diet: Proper nutrition supports tissue repair and boosts overall recovery.
- Avoid Smoking and Alcohol: Smoking can hinder healing by reducing oxygen flow to the tissues, while alcohol may interfere with medications.
- Be Patient with Your Body: Healing takes time. Never compare your progress to others, focus on your unique journey.
